Okay i reformatted my computer but when the computer first boots up it says disk boot failure insert the system disk. So i put a windows 98 boot up disk inside of the computer and i tryed to delete the partition of the harddrive on fdisk. But it said Error Reading Fixed disk.

Try doing a COLD boot.
When formatting from a XP computer I had the same problem and found that shutting the computer off.. waiting 30 seconds, and then power on, everything went fine from a win98 start up or winme start up is better.

YOu also have to make sure that the bios is booting from the floopy FIRST of course.
